Another A-Pillar Dilemma
So i found that Lowes actually carries the GM nylon fastners that will suffice for A-pillar installation. I cleaned up a straight, quality set i got from a buddy for my 90' t-top Iroc. Re-applied 3M weather stripping and put in the nylon fastners. Got the drivers's side pillar in without any problems and while it's not saggin from the front view (where you'd see it from sitting in the drivers seat) ther is still a noticeable gap on the outside looking into the car between the actual a-pillar and the a-pillar trim. Is this just a case of the fastner being too short? Does anyone else have this same gap, perhaps it's normal, or understand what i'm talking about w/out a pic? Advice, ideas appreciated, thanks.
